The sweet spot? A mix of **equity, debt, and tax-saving instruments** that balance growth and safety. Here’s how to do it:

1. The SIP + Index Fund Combo (For Long-Term Wealth)

Think of a **Systematic Investment Plan (SIP)** like your daily cup of chai—small, consistent, and over time, it adds up to something big. Here’s how it works:

  • You invest a fixed amount (e.g., **₹5,000/month**) in a **Nifty 50 or Nifty Next 50 index fund** (like the ones offered by Zerodha or Groww).
  • The fund buys shares of India’s top 50 or 100 companies, so you’re not betting on one stock.
  • Historically, the Nifty 50 has given **12-15% annual returns** over 10+ years.

Example: If you invest **₹10,000/month** in a Nifty 50 SIP for **15 years**, you’d end up with **~₹70 lakh** (assuming **12% returns**). That’s the power of compounding—your money makes money, which then makes more money.

2. The PPF + Tax-Saving FD Combo (For Safety + Tax Benefits)

Not all your money should be in the stock market. A portion should be in **safe, tax-efficient instruments** like:

  • Public Provident Fund (PPF): Gives **7-8% returns**, is **tax-free under Section 80C**, and has a **15-year lock-in** (which is actually good—it forces you to stay invested).
  • Tax-Saving Fixed Deposits (FDs): Offer **5-6% returns**, lock in for **5 years**, and also qualify for **80C deductions**.

Rule of thumb: Allocate **20-30% of your side hustle income** to these safe options. Think of them like the **airbags in your car**—you hope you never need them, but you’re glad they’re there.

3. The Emergency Fund (Because Life Happens)

Before you invest a single rupee, set aside **3-6 months’ worth of expenses** in a **liquid fund or high-interest savings account** (like those from **IDFC First Bank or Kotak 811**). Why? Because if you lose your job, get sick, or face a family emergency, you don’t want to sell your investments at a loss.

Example: If your monthly expenses are **₹30,000**, keep **₹90,000–₹1.8 lakh** in an emergency fund. This is your **financial shock absorber**—it keeps you from derailing your wealth-building journey.

The Tax-Saving Hacks That Keep More of Your Hard-Earned Money

Taxes are the silent wealth killer. If you’re not careful, the government can take **20-30% of your side hustle income** in taxes. But with a few smart moves, you can legally save ₹50,000–₹1.5 lakh/year** in taxes. Here’s how:

1. Use Section 80C to the Max (₹1.5 Lakh Deduction)

Under **Section 80C**, you can claim deductions for:

  • PPF contributions (up to **₹1.5 lakh/year**)
  • ELSS (Equity-Linked Savings Scheme) mutual funds (lock-in of **3 years**, but gives **12-15% returns**)
  • Tax-saving FDs (5-year lock-in, **5-6% returns**)
  • NPS (National Pension System) (extra **₹50,000 deduction** under **Section 80CCD(1B)**)

Example: If you invest **₹1.5 lakh in PPF + ₹50,000 in NPS**, you save **₹60,000+ in taxes** (assuming you’re in the **30% tax bracket**).

2. Deduct Business Expenses (If Your Side Hustle Is a Business)

If your side hustle is registered as a **proprietorship or freelance business**, you can deduct:

  • Internet and phone bills (proportionate to business use)
  • Laptop, camera, or software subscriptions (like Canva Pro or Adobe Creative Cloud)
  • Travel expenses (if you attend client meetings or events)
  • Home office rent (if you work from home)

Example: If you earn **₹5 lakh/year** from freelancing and claim **₹2 lakh in expenses**, you only pay tax on **₹3 lakh**—saving you **₹60,000 in taxes**.

3. Use the Presumptive Taxation Scheme (For Freelancers)

If your side hustle income is **under ₹50 lakh/year**, you can opt for the **presumptive taxation scheme (Section 44ADA)**. This lets you pay tax on only **50% of your income** (the rest is assumed to be expenses).

Example: If you earn **₹20 lakh/year** from freelancing, you only pay tax on **₹10 lakh**—saving you **₹3 lakh in taxes** (assuming **30% bracket**).
